Re: Tail lights mod
« Reply #11 on: October 26, 2009, 10:48:29 PM »

Has anyone removed the International tail light? Is there another smaller and better looking one that can bolt on in it's place? Can the signal lenses be changed to a clear or red lens?

Having the same nightmares... but I think i have it figured out.

Was just over to a US dealer and noticed that the US bike brake/running/turn signals are actually smoked grey but shine red. Part number 69383-09 (left) and 69407-09 (right). They are the whole light assembly and will swap out for our amber ones... a little pricey though...$195 each

Step 2 get a Layback smoked grey lense for the canadian tail lamp.... I think it will all blend together nicely

At least it all looks like it belongs

Re: Tail lights mod
« Reply #12 on: October 27, 2009, 03:07:39 AM »

If you do swap out the LED's you need a new harness 70338-09 as the HDI one only runs the turn signals.
